Transaction 074259fdcd5e0c8b14b14f077ceb1c5381d897eb129fc4e0027eb41f6a988d31

4 Input
2 Outputs
  • 074259fdcd5e0c8b14b14f077ceb1c5381d897eb129fc4e0027eb41f6a988d31:0
  • value  6050122
    address  3KWk13WQEazr5Xstu7oYWrjBuJEh8AvJKr
  • 074259fdcd5e0c8b14b14f077ceb1c5381d897eb129fc4e0027eb41f6a988d31:1
  • value  53937603
    address  199coCnMvXeDPin6geq7cyEAMEK2JgizDZ